Country Hideaway is a 2 bedroom log cabin with a loft. The Master Bedroom has a King size bed with full bath, TV and French doors open to deck where Hot Tub awaits you for soaking and relaxing is located on the main floor. Living room has TV, Gas Fireplace and full kitchen with washer and dryer also located on main floor. The loft area has a pool table, jacuzzi tub, full bath and a Queen size bed. Full access to wrap around porch from front door and from kitchen. Country Hideaway is less than 2 miles from the entrance Dollywood, Dolly Splash County and Pigeon Forge. Country Hideaway is the perfect getaway for a couple on a romantic weekend or a small family on their dream vacation. During the months of November - March , 4 wheel drive and/or chains are required in case of inclement weather. *THIS CABIN IS NOT PET OR SMOKE FRIENDLY

Sevierville is home to this cabin. The area's natural beauty can be seen at The Ripken Experience - Pigeon Forge and Great Smoky Mountains National Park, while Titanic Museum and Dolly Parton's Stampede Dinner Attraction are cultural highlights. Dollywood and Dollywood's Splash Country are not to be missed.
